A good version of the classic original Caesar Salad

- 1 clove garlic, halved
- 1 egg
- ¼ tsp dry mustard
- ¼ tsp fresh ground black pepper
- ½ tsp salt
- 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 6 TBS olive oil
- 4 TBS lemon juice
- ¼ tsp garlic salt
- ½ tsp Worcestershire sauce
- 2-3 heads Romaine lettuce, torn and chilled
- 2 cups croutons
- Rub wooden salad bowl generously with garlic
- Break egg into bowl and stir briskly with fork until egg is no longer stringy
- Add mustard, pepper, salt, ¼ cup parmesan, and oil and mix well
- Stir in lemon juice; sprinkle with garlic salt and Worcestershire;
- Add lettuce and toss
- Sprinkle with 1 cup of croutons and 1/8 cup of parmesan and toss again. Repeat
Serves 6-8
